Product Overview

FOXBORO SY-60301002RB — Backplane Motherboard for SCD6000 Scalable Controller Domain Architecture

The SY-60301002RB is the central backplane motherboard within FOXBORO’s SCD6000 Scalable Controller Domain platform, a distributed control system architecture deployed extensively across oil & gas, power generation, chemical processing, and pulp & paper industries. This board is not a peripheral — it is the physical and electrical substrate upon which every controller module, I/O interface, and communication processor in the SCD6000 chassis depends. Its failure is equivalent to a loss of the entire controller domain; its integrity is therefore a non-negotiable element of plant availability.

Within the I/A Series DCS hierarchy, the SCD6000 domain controller manages real-time process loops, executes control algorithms, and arbitrates fieldbus communications. The SY-60301002RB provides the backplane bus that interconnects these functional modules, distributing power rails, synchronization signals, and inter-module data paths across the rack. The board’s passive and active backplane design allows hot-swap of controller and I/O modules without interrupting the bus, a critical requirement in continuous-process environments where planned shutdowns are measured in months, not days.

Hardware Logical Analysis

The SY-60301002RB implements a hybrid backplane topology that separates high-speed inter-controller data paths from lower-speed I/O polling buses. This architectural decision is deliberate: it prevents I/O scan cycle jitter from contaminating the deterministic timing of the controller execution loop. In a DCS environment where control loop scan rates are typically 100 ms to 500 ms, any bus contention that introduces variable latency into the controller’s data acquisition phase directly degrades loop performance and can cause derivative kick in PID controllers operating near their tuning limits.

The board’s power distribution layer uses a multi-rail design, isolating the logic supply (typically 5 VDC) from the I/O interface supply (typically 24 VDC) at the backplane level. This isolation prevents ground loops and common-mode noise from I/O field wiring from coupling into the controller’s logic circuits — a fundamental EMC design requirement in industrial environments where variable-frequency drives, large contactors, and high-current switching loads are present in the same electrical infrastructure.

Synchronization signals distributed across the backplane allow multiple controller modules in a redundant configuration to maintain time-coherent state. The SCD6000 platform supports 1:1 controller redundancy, and the SY-60301002RB’s backplane arbitration logic manages the primary/standby role assignment and bumpless transfer handshake. The arbitration is hardware-implemented, not firmware-dependent, which means a controller module firmware fault cannot corrupt the redundancy switchover mechanism — a critical safety design principle.

The board’s connector system uses gold-plated, high-cycle-count edge connectors rated for repeated module insertion and extraction. This is not incidental — in a live plant environment, I/O modules may be swapped during maintenance windows dozens of times over the system’s operational life. Connector degradation is a documented failure mode in backplane boards that use lower-grade contact materials; the SY-60301002RB’s connector specification addresses this directly.
